Role Overview

Scrum Master to lead end-to-end delivery of complex technology projects and programs for a client in the United States (Remote). This is a contract (W2 only) role.

Responsibilities

  • Delivery leadership & execution: Own end-to-end delivery across multiple platforms and teams.
  • Planning: Create and manage integrated delivery plans (milestones, dependencies, timelines, success metrics).
  • Methodology selection: Tailor delivery approaches (Agile/Scrum, Waterfall, Hybrid) to initiative needs.
  • Risk/issue management: Identify risks and constraints early, assess probability/severity/business impact, and drive mitigation plans.
  • Escalation & decision support: Resolve complex delivery challenges and provide escalation with options, trade-offs, and recommendations.
  • Stakeholder engagement: Partner with business, product, engineering, and leadership stakeholders; translate complex topics into clear communication.
  • Facilitation: Enable decisions across teams with competing priorities; build trusted relationships through influence.
  • Quality, security, and customer focus: Champion continuous improvement and proactively address security, compliance, and operational considerations; keep teams focused on outcomes and value.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ent practical experience).
  • Significant experience leading complex enterprise technology projects/programs.
  • Proven delivery success on high-visibility or high-risk initiatives with minimal oversight.
  • Strong command of Agile, Waterfall, and Hybrid delivery methodologies.
  • Experience managing delivery across multiple teams/platforms/systems.
  • Excellent communication, stakeholder management, and influencing skills.

Preferred

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ills in ambiguous environments.
  • Ability to anticipate problems, drive clarity, and stabilize complex initiatives.
  • PMI PMP (or similar) certification.

AI Tooling Expectations (Contract Requirement)

  • Use enterprise-approved AI tools for at least 90% weekly usage (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Microsoft 365 Copilot, other approved GenAI tools).
  • Apply AI to improve coding, documentation, data analysis, and decision-making workflows.
  • Continuously learn and incorporate new AI capabilities to increase delivery quality and velocity.
